Pulvinula johannis ?
Patrice TANCHAUD, 10-02-2013 23:40
Bonsoir,

Sur sol un peu sablonneux, plus ou moins parmi les mousses, au long d'une haie de Cupressus. Asques 155-195 µm. Spores (8,5)9,5-10(11) µm. J'arrive à Pulvinula johannis (cf. Sydowia 60(2): 248, 2008), mais ce qui me gêne c'est que je ne vois pas de spores uniguttulées. Merci d'avance pour vos avis éventuels.

On sandy ground a little among mosses, along a Cupressus hedge. Asci 155-195 µm. Spores (8,5)9,5-10(11) µm. I think it coult be Pulvinula johannis (cf. Sydowia 60 (2): 248, 2008), but there is a problem, I do not see spores with one guttule. Thank you in advance for your advice possible. (Sorry for bad english ...)
